什么是 generator-oss?
generator-oss 是一个基于 Yeoman 的 npm 包,用于生成一个可上传至 OSS(阿里云对象存储服务)的 Vue.js 项目。该包不仅能够快速生成项目骨架,还包含了开箱即用的上传至 OSS 的功能,非常适合需要将 Vue.js 项目部署至 OSS 的开发者使用。
如何安装和使用?
安装
在开始使用 generator-oss 之前,需要先安装它。打开终端(Terminal)并输入以下命令即可:
npm install -g yo generator-oss
使用
完成安装后,就可以使用 generator-oss 生成一个新的 Vue.js 项目。首先,我们需要使用以下命令在本地创建一个新的项目文件夹:
mkdir my-project && cd my-project
然后使用以下命令生成项目:
yo oss
生成过程中,你将会被询问一些问题,如项目名称、阿里云账号等信息,按照提示逐步完成即可。完成后,你将获得一个包含上传至 OSS 功能的 Vue.js 项目,可以直接用于部署。
如果需要在已有的 Vue.js 项目中添加上传至 OSS 的功能,可以使用以下命令:
yo oss:upload
该命令将会在你的项目中添加上传至 OSS 的功能。
Code 示例
以下是一个简单的上传文件至 OSS 的示例代码,仅供参考:
-- -------------------- ---- ------- ----- --- - ------------------ ----- ------ - --- ----- ------------ -------------------- ---------------- ------------------------ ------- ------------------- ------- --------------------- --------- ---------------- -- ----- -------- --------- - --- - ----- ------ - ----- ---------------------------------- ------------------------- ------------------- ---------- - ----- --- - ------------------- -------- -- - - ---------
结语
generator-oss 已经大大简化了部署 Vue.js 项目至 OSS 的过程,让我们能够更加专注于项目本身的开发。希望这篇文章对你有所帮助,祝你的项目越来越好!
来源:JavaScript中文网 ,转载请注明来源 https://www.javascriptcn.com/post/6005587981e8991b448d5b9b